Subject: DR drill — checkout load test, Thursday

Hey Priya,

Quick heads-up: we're running the disaster-recovery drill on the Cartwheel checkout flow Thursday at 10:00. Marlow will hammer it with 5k synthetic orders while we fail over to the Norvik cluster. To unlock the drill-mode console, use the passphrase below.

unlock words, yawig-kagef: gordor-holvan-ulaael-pramir-ulaiel-tamdor

Leadership Review Briefing — Ostvale Region Sales

Quick picture for department heads: Ostvale came in 7% over target, mostly on the Brightline range. Renewals softened a touch in the south district; Petra Ulm is digging into why. Headcount request is deferred to next cycle. The related confidential plan is noted directly below.

confidential, kagup-bafog: Fraaxax Group is in early talks to buy Soroxox Group for about $343.8 million. The Olidor launch date is June 14, and nothing goes to the press before then. Legal wants the Aldmirek Logistics term sheet signed before July 23.

Handover — Weekend Lift Maintenance, Corvane House

Hi Priya, taking over from my Friday shift: Mallow Vertical Services will service both passenger lifts Saturday from 07:00 to roughly 15:00. The goods lift stays live for deliveries, but it must be manually released each trip from the basement panel. Please log every engineer arrival in the red folder at the desk and walk them to the motor room yourself — they cannot roam unescorted. To open the motor-room door during the works, use the code below.

door code, yagap-bahof: bdg-O-05

Ticket #4481 — Plugin signature verification failing intermittently

Several plugin authors on the Hollowgate marketplace reported sporadic signature check failures during publish. Root cause: our verification service resolves the manifest host through a flaky internal DNS resolver, occasionally returning a stale record and fetching an outdated manifest, so the signature no longer matches. We've pinned the resolver and added retries. Authors affected during the outage should re-sign and republish. For re-signing, use the current key shown here.

release key, fajef-kajeg: bky19_LdLu6Ne6FLi8he2c24d